OBJECTIVE OF THE POSITION
Planning, coordinating, implementing and monitoring all logistics activities in the project related to Water, Health and Sanitation, according to MSF protocols and standards in order to ensure an optimal running of the project
RESPONSIBILITIES
- In collaboration with the Project Coordinator and the Logistics Coordinator, planning, elaborating and reviewing the annual budget for the Watsan (Water, Health and Sanitation) activities in order to identify and give a response to the needs of the mission and the targeted population.
- Monitoring on a day-to-day basis the implementation of the Watsan activities in the project ensuring compliance of MSF standards, protocols and procedures, and reporting to the Project Coordinator on the development of the ongoing programmes including the following:
- Designing, implementing and managing all interventions in the project. (including, but not limited to: water supply, excreta disposal, waste management, hygiene, and infection control)
- Conducting routine assessments in collaboration with project medical teams to identify Watsan needs at project level, and making recommendations for response activities to the line manager (e.g. Project/Field Coordinator, Watsan Coordinator/Referent). Ensuring the Watsan contribution to the development and planning of emergency response strategies and resources, in collaboration with the medical and logistical teams
- Ensuring availability, proper purchasing, and appropriate technical specifications of required materials and equipment through planning, organizing and overseeing the inventory of the stock
- In collaboration with the Project Coordinator, Logistics Coordinator and the HR Coordinator, participating in the planning and implementation of HR associated processes (recruitment, training, briefing/debriefing, evaluation, detection of potential, development and communication) of the staff under his/her responsibility in order to ensure both the sizing and the amount of knowledge required to correctly perform all logistics activities pertaining to his/her area
- Providing technical support to the medical team in identifying possible "risk factors" (e.g. behavioral practices, environmental sources of infection, and transmission routes) and offers solutions for infection control. Actively contributing to the integration of Watsan activities in the medical intervention offering project proposals and work plans.
- Ensuring proper collection and monitoring of data. Ensuring multidisciplinary data availability. Providing analysis of data and regular reporting of results (as requested by line management)

POSITION CONDITIONS
Work Venue: Where the needs of the project require it
Profits: Monthly remuneration: in the first 12 months, the bonus approximate gross monthly is USD $1,500. From the second year remuneration increases based on experience (previous and acquired) and the level of responsibility in the field. Private insurance coverage that includes medical coverage and hospital, temporary disability and life insurance. The organization also has an arranged medical evacuation if necessary. The expenses of stay in the land are covered: housing, basic services, cleaning and washing. Other expenses such as transportation, visas, transfer to the country of destination and Displacements in the field will also be covered by MSF. Per diem or monthly per diem: mainly to cover meals and small personal expenses.
Start: Depending on the needs of the project
Duration: Minimum 6 months
Working day: Full time
